JATS (Jordan Airline
Training and Simulation) is pleased to announce that it has
successfully completed the annual surveillance audit conducted by
EASA (European Aviation Safety Agency) for
Airbus A318/A319/A320/A321 (CFM 56 + IAE V2500) T1+T2
and A340 (CFM 56) T1+T2. JATS will commence
maintenance training courses for the aforementioned engines under
the EASA Part 147 approvals.
This certification is
an achievement for JATS’ management and staff and will be of an
added value to the previous certification of the
Airbus
A318/A319/A320/A321
CFM 56-5 Engine
obtained in 2009.
This new
certification will allow JATS to increase its market share by
conquering the international aviation maintenance training industry,
particularly Europe and the Middle East regions.
JATS also recently
received the JCARC (Jordan Civil Aviation Regulatory Commission)
certification for meeting all the requirements to operate an
approved training center with the following ratings: Flight
Operation Training, Engineering & Maintenance and Cabin Safety &
Services Training.
JATS is the pioneer
and most advanced aviation training centre in the Middle East, where
it provides the highest and finest quality pilot, cabin crew and
maintenance training standards. JATS is currently operating 4
full-flight simulators (2 A320’s, A310 and B767) and will be
installing B737 and Embraer simulators in October and December,
respectively.
